Postby Platypus Bureaucracy » Thu Jun 21, 2018 7:26 am

Alvecia wrote:
Platypus Bureaucracy wrote:Well, the article isn't clear on that:

Johnson's trilogy was the first to be announced, so I would guess it's that, but we can't be sure.

Huh. I’ve seen elsewhere that the two projects mentioned there were to be the focus going forward. I’ll have to double check.

Hmm, you're right. From the original Collider article:
In addition to Episode IX, Lucasfilm has officially announced development on a new Star Wars trilogy focused on new characters from The Last Jedi writer/director Rian Johnson, as well as a new series of films written by Game of Thrones showrunners David Benioff and D.B. Weiss. These projects continue to be in development and are not part of the paused spinoffs we’re hearing about. But Lucasfilm’s main focus at the moment is planning the next trilogy after the Abrams-directed Star Wars 9, which is expected to conclude the story of Rey (Daisy Ridley) that began with The Force Awakens.

It sounds like the trilogy referred to is separate from both Johnson's and D&D's. On the other hand, if they're cancelling spin-offs it's entirely possible those trilogies will never get beyond the development stage either.
